How do landscape tables perform in areas with frequent seismic activity?
Landscape tables, often used in outdoor spaces like parks, gardens, and patios, face unique challenges in areas prone to seismic activity. Their performance during earthquakes depends on design, material, and installation methods.
Design Considerations:
Earthquake-resistant landscape tables incorporate features like flexible joints, reinforced bases, and lightweight yet durable materials. These elements help absorb seismic energy, reducing the risk of collapse or damage.
Material Choices:
Materials such as aluminum, tempered glass, and high-density plastics are preferred for their balance of strength and flexibility. Stone or concrete tables, while sturdy, may require additional reinforcement to withstand tremors.
Installation Tips:
Proper anchoring is critical. Tables should be bolted to stable foundations or secured with ground anchors. In high-risk zones, modular designs allow for easy disassembly and relocation if needed.
Maintenance and Inspection:
Regular checks for cracks, loose fittings, or corrosion ensure longevity. Post-earthquake inspections are essential to assess structural integrity.
By prioritizing resilient design and proactive maintenance, landscape tables can remain functional and safe even in seismically active regions.
